How to Play
To play Friends Race to the Chest, start by clicking the big play button on the game page. One player controls the red character using the WASD keys on the keyboard, while the other controls the blue character using the arrow keys. The goal is to collect items scattered around the play area and bring them to the chest. Players can work together or compete to see who can score the most points. The game is easy to learn but offers fun challenges that require quick movement and strategic planning.
